IMF director: PrivatBank nationalization needed to ensure stability

KIEV, Dec. 19 – International Monetary Fund Managing Director Christine Lagarde has welcomed the decision of the Ukrainian government and the National Bank of Ukraine on the nationalization of PrivatBank, the largest bank in the country, as it is an important step to ensure financial stability.


G7 ambassadors praise government's decision to nationalize Privatbank

KIEV, Dec. 19 – Ambassadors of the Group of Seven (G7) countries have praised the Ukrainian government's decision to nationalize PrivatBank and expressed their hope for strengthening the country's banking sector.


Finnish company pulls out of Kharkiv JV, citing government harassment

KIEV, Dec. 18 – A project on joint production of harvesters between Kharkiv Tractor Plant and Sampo Rosenlew (Finland) which planned to produce a test batch of harvesters this year, has been frozen under the initiative of Finland due to “unjustifiable claims“ of the tax service to collect over UAH 400 million from the plant and attempts to nationalize the enterprise Kharkiv Tractor Plant, Kharkiv Tractor Plant Director Vladyslav Hubin said.


NBU board decides to retain refinancing rate at 22%, citing inflation

KIEV, Dec. 17 – The Board of the National Bank of Ukraine on December 17 decided to retain its refinancing rate at 22%, the NBU said in a press release.


Britain's Ferrexpo Plc denies reports it plans 40% PGOK layoff

KIEV, Dec. 17 – British-based Ferrexpo Plc, which controls Poltava and Yerystove mining and processing plants (PGOK, YeGOK), has said that reports of the company's plan to lay off 40% of employees at PGOK spread by mass media are untrue.

Polish and Ukrainian pipeline operators consider capacity expansion

WARSAW, Dec. 17 - Polish and Ukrainian state gas pipeline operators signed an agreement on Wednesday to look into expanding their capacity to transport gas between the two countries, the Polish pipeline group Gaz-System said in a statement, Reuters reported.


Ukrainian natural gas imports spike sharply so far this month

KIEV, Dec. 17 - Ukraine imported 472.8 million cubic meters of natural gas from Europe in December 1 through December 15, up from about 58 million cu m in the same period a year ago, UkrTransGaz, the state-owned gas shipper, reported Wednesday.


Kiev office center vacancy rates projected to soar next year

KIEV, Dec. 20 – The vacancy rate of office centers in Kiev in 2013 could grow from current 14% to 20%, according to Oleksandr Nosachenko a managing director of Colliers International Consulting Company in Ukraine.
